1. He could have given me some advice.

(Does this sentence mean that he didn't give me some advice?)

2. He cold have told a lie.
(Does this sentence mean that he didn't told a lie? Or does #2 mean #3?)

3. He may have told a lie.

1 answer

1. Right, he didn't give advice even though he could have.

2. I'd take this to mean he could have but didn't.

3. This is different. There is doubt whether he told a lie or not.
